Transaction 6ccaa113ec0ed118cf292270223993ca5b89518d06e1cbac4a2b8a12f9dc494d
1 Input
1 Output
-
6ccaa113ec0ed118cf292270223993ca5b89518d06e1cbac4a2b8a12f9dc494d:0
- value
- 363001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52a06c3d7241bec6c47016f5f354a844bcf71843 OP_EQUAL
- address
- 39DuWeSKwxaQNrm6g66potczhxRKLJAzuR